The savings/investment process in capitalist economies is organized around financial intermediation, making them a central institution of economic growth. Financial intermediaries are firms that borrow from consumer/savers and lend to companies that need resources for investment. We explain informed capital by showing that projects can be screened by comparing loan applicants. Because efficient comparing requires centralized monitoring, it represents a novel rationale for financial intermediation. Positive scale effects may make a single monopoly intermediary optimal. Comparing can also eliminate the problems of adverse selection and inefficient investments.
